#8164d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8164d5 is composed of 50.6% red, 39.2%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 255.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 61.4%. #8164d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#0300ab.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

● #8164d5 color description : Moderate violet.
#8164d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8164d5 has RGB values of R:129, G:100,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8479957.

Shades and Tints of #8164d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
